example 1
[0005] The production method of propylene glycol alginate emulsifier, the main steps are: add 30kg of calcium alginate, 40kg of sodium alginate, and 50kg of alginic acid into the reaction kettle, feed excess propylene oxide gas at 60°C for 50 minutes, and cool to 10°C, vacuum filter, wash with ethyl acetate solution for 1 h, recrystallize in cyclohexane solution, dry and pulverize to finally obtain the finished product, wherein the mass fraction of ethyl acetate solution is 30%, and the mass fraction of cyclohexane solution is 45% %.

example 2
[0009] The production method of propylene glycol alginate emulsifier, the main steps are: add 30kg of calcium alginate, 45kg of sodium alginate, and 53kg of alginic acid into the reaction kettle, feed excess propylene oxide gas at 65°C for 70 minutes, and cool to At 13°C, vacuum filter, wash with ethyl acetate solution for 2 hours, recrystallize in cyclohexane solution, dry and pulverize to finally obtain the finished product, wherein the mass fraction of ethyl acetate solution is 34%, and the mass fraction of cyclohexane solution is 47%. %.
